From e68ded449fb5d1f94568cc9e6dcb13d12e151c8f Mon Sep 17 00:00:00 2001 From: Tim Mayberry Date: Sat, 28 Feb 2015 12:00:48 +1000 Subject: [PATCH] Use Gtk::Notebook::append_page rather than deprecated API --- gtk2_ardour/engine_dialog.cc | 6 +++--- gtk2_ardour/export_report.cc | 2 +- gtk2_ardour/lua_script_manager.cc | 5 ++--- gtk2_ardour/route_params_ui.cc | 8 ++++---- 4 files changed, 10 insertions(+), 11 deletions(-) diff --git a/gtk2_ardour/engine_dialog.cc b/gtk2_ardour/engine_dialog.cc index 4dc806763f..f23d6278fd 100644 --- a/gtk2_ardour/engine_dialog.cc +++ b/gtk2_ardour/engine_dialog.cc @@ -244,9 +244,9 @@ EngineControl::EngineControl () /* pack it all up */ - notebook.pages().push_back (TabElem (basic_vbox, _("Audio"))); - notebook.pages().push_back (TabElem (lm_vbox, _("Latency"))); - notebook.pages().push_back (TabElem (midi_vbox, _("MIDI"))); + notebook.append_page (basic_vbox, _("Audio")); + notebook.append_page (lm_vbox, _("Latency")); + notebook.append_page (midi_vbox, _("MIDI")); notebook.set_border_width (12); notebook.set_show_tabs (false); diff --git a/gtk2_ardour/export_report.cc b/gtk2_ardour/export_report.cc index 67e2f61e7d..0f83da6415 100644 --- a/gtk2_ardour/export_report.cc +++ b/gtk2_ardour/export_report.cc @@ -835,7 +835,7 @@ ExportReport::init (const AnalysisResults & ar, bool with_file) l->show(); tab->show(); img->hide(); - pages.pages ().push_back (Notebook_Helpers::TabElem (*vb, *tab)); + pages.append_page (*vb, *tab); pages.signal_switch_page().connect (sigc::mem_fun (*this, &ExportReport::on_switch_page)); if (png_surface) { diff --git a/gtk2_ardour/lua_script_manager.cc b/gtk2_ardour/lua_script_manager.cc index c33dea3e55..5a7673e4da 100644 --- a/gtk2_ardour/lua_script_manager.cc +++ b/gtk2_ardour/lua_script_manager.cc @@ -67,7 +67,7 @@ LuaScriptManager::LuaScriptManager () vbox->pack_end (*edit_box, false, false); vbox->show_all (); - pages.pages ().push_back (Notebook_Helpers::TabElem (*vbox, "Action Scripts")); + pages.append_page (*vbox, "Action Scripts"); /* action hooks page */ @@ -96,8 +96,7 @@ LuaScriptManager::LuaScriptManager () vbox->pack_end (*edit_box, false, false); vbox->show_all (); - pages.pages ().push_back (Notebook_Helpers::TabElem (*vbox, "Action Hooks")); - + pages.append_page (*vbox, "Action Hooks"); add (pages); pages.show(); diff --git a/gtk2_ardour/route_params_ui.cc b/gtk2_ardour/route_params_ui.cc index a8ddc02c1f..4405e0b1b5 100644 --- a/gtk2_ardour/route_params_ui.cc +++ b/gtk2_ardour/route_params_ui.cc @@ -100,10 +100,10 @@ RouteParams_UI::RouteParams_UI () list_vpacker.pack_start (route_select_frame, true, true); - notebook.pages().push_back (TabElem (input_frame, _("Inputs"))); - notebook.pages().push_back (TabElem (output_frame, _("Outputs"))); - notebook.pages().push_back (TabElem (redir_hpane, _("Plugins, Inserts & Sends"))); - notebook.pages().push_back (TabElem (latency_frame, _("Latency"))); + notebook.append_page (input_frame, _("Inputs")); + notebook.append_page (output_frame, _("Outputs")); + notebook.append_page (redir_hpane, _("Plugins, Inserts & Sends")); + notebook.append_page (latency_frame, _("Latency")); notebook.set_name ("InspectorNotebook");